Once you’ve submitted your application form, you could receive one of the following offers:
There are no conditions you need to meet to secure your place on your chosen course.
You need to meet certain conditions, such as academic and English language requirements, to secure your place. Your specific conditions will vary depending on your course type, subject, university and study length. You’ll find full details in your offer letter.

While our courses will equip you with the academic skills you need to excel at university, you’ll need a certain amount of previous education to study with us.
This usually involves completion of education for a specified length of time or to a specified study level, such as a high school diploma or undergraduate degree.
Each course has a required level of English, which is assessed using a range of approved tests.
Depending on the type of course you’ve applied for, you may need to take a Secure English Language Test such as IELTS. For some courses, such as our iCAS options, alternative English language tests may be accepted.
If you don’t meet the English language requirement for your desired pathway program, don’t worry we offer a range of courses to help you boost your score.
